词汇 semiotician
释义 semiotician
noun[ C ]
 language, social science specializeduk /ˌsem.i.əˈtɪʃ.ən/ us /ˌsem.i.əˈtɪʃ.ən/
a person who studies semiotics (= the meaning and use of signs and symbols): 符号学家
Many semioticians are interested in marketing.许多符号学家对营销感兴趣。
the Italian semiotician, novelist, and critic Umberto Eco意大利符号学家、小说家和评论家翁贝托·艾柯
